ONDCP’s Model Acts initiative funds efforts to advise states on establishing laws and evidence-based policies to prevent and treat substance use, provide support to those in recovery, and enhance and support sensible criminal justice efforts.

The recipient of the 2019 – 2021 Model Acts grant is the Legislative Analysis and Public Policy Association (LAPPA). With ONDCP funding, LAPPA conducts research and analysis on effective model laws, provides technical assistance to legislators, and drafts model legislation on current and emerging illicit drug issues.

Through this initiative, state legislators nationwide have passed legislation to support greater access to naloxone, established processes by which emergency health service professionals refer overdose survivors to treatment services, increased recovery housing and other support services in colleges, and, in general, enhanced and promoted evidence-based substance use programming across the country.
